We here at Lund Racing desire to provide a repeatable, predictable, and desirable outcome for the consumers we serve. Some products in this industry are just not up to our standards and we will no longer be supporting them.
As of March 2025, we are changing how we support -OR- not support the following items:
*We will disclaim on some items after purchase if you list it!
*Note existing customers retain legacy support for some of these items.
- Roush 2650 Gen 3 Superchargers
- NA Throttle Body “upgrades” (*reserved for CJ manifold only)
- We will disclaim on NA aftermarket intake “upgrades” – Stock Airbox with an air filter or PMAS is our go to choice for reliability and repeatability.
- DeatschWerks Injectors
- DeatschWerks Drop-In / In-Tank Pumps
- Whipple-Supplied "55lb" Injectors
- Whipple CobraJet 150mm CAI (*reserved for racecars)
- On3 Supplied MAP Sensors
- On3 Return Fuel Systems
- Return Fuel Systems with Hat-Mounted Regulators
- 2011-2014 F150 Platform
- HPTuners Devices on Gen 1 Mustangs
- HPTuners Devices on Coyote Swaps
- HPTuners Devices for PCMTech
- HPTuners Locked nGauges
- Ratio-Tek Valve Body(ies)
- DI Deletes Support (we will be picky about this and vehicles it is used on - generally it is meant for 2000+ rwhp race cars)
- Locked Out Cams on any vehicle not approved in advance by LR
- All Aftermarket Coil Packs (OEM only - we have never supported aftermarket coil packs)
- SCT X3 / Livewire TS Devices
